9/11 Documents Show Hijacking Warnings
(AP)

9/11 Documents Show Hijacking Warnings
(AP)
04/09/2004 05:22 PM

AP - U.S. government agencies issued repeated warnings in the summer of 2001 about potential terrorist plots against the United States masterminded by Osama bin Laden, including a possible plan to hijack commercial aircraft, documents show.

A tip for Xcode users...

One of the things about Xcode is that, when a build has errors or warnings, it’s not as obvious as it was in Project Builder.

So what I did was assign a keyboard shortcut—shift-cmd-E—to the command to show errors and warnings. It’s become automatic after doing a build: I hit that shortcut to see what happened.

Spammers Hijacking Servers Is Nothing
New


Spammers Hijacking Servers Is Nothing
New
11/10/2003 11:02 PM
While there are plenty of stories these days about spammers hijacking computers around the world to send out more spam, you might not realize that this is nothing new. A story published five years ago said that, at the time, one in five corporate servers was being hijacked for spam. In other words, five years later and we haven't done much to solve the sneaky methods spammers use to send out their junk mail.

Malware Hijacking Google Homepage


Malware Hijacking Google Homepage 10/28/2003 11:08 PM
A lot of malware has been going around lately, some of it preventing you from visiting the actual Google website, or putting up a notice when you try to visit. The most common reason for this is spyware or malware -- software that's included with other programs and stows away in your computer watching what you're doing, popping up ads, and doing other bad things. To get rid of it, you can install LavaSoft's Ad-Aware or Spybot Search and Destroy. Both are free but neither me nor Google are recommending either....

N.Y. Lawmakers Target Modem Hijacking
(AP)


N.Y. Lawmakers Target Modem Hijacking
(AP)
04/04/2005 09:41 PM
AP - State lawmakers unveiled a bill Monday that is believed to be the first in the nation to target modem hijacking, a practice in which thieves tap into people's computer modems to make international phone calls.
